noun
a puff on a marijuana cigarette or pipe After about three tokes each, they head off for 7-11, and return with chocolate grahams, Ritz crackers, ginger ale, and milk.—Laura E. Fry
Then he squatted a little distance away and rolled and lit a joint, taking a couple of long lazy tokes.—John Nichols
"吸入大麻香烟或烟斗的行为",1968年,美国俚语,源自早期动词的意思是“吸食大麻香烟”(1952年),可能来自西班牙语 tocar,意为“触摸,轻敲,打击”或“获得一份或一部分”。在19世纪,英国俚语中的同一词语意味着“质量差的小块面包”,但可能与此无关。
American Spanish toque, from Spanish, touch, test, from tocar to touch, from Vulgar Latin *toccare — more at touch >entry 1
The first known use of toke was in 1968
